Lopuksi kiitämme kaikkia vieraita.

Questions & Answers about Lopuksi kiitämme kaikkia vieraita.

Why is the translative case used in lopuksi?
While you likely first learned the translative case (ending in -ksi) to show a change in state, it is also heavily used to form adverbs indicating a sequence or role. Here, lopuksi literally means "as an end" or "in closing". Other common examples of this sequence building are aluksi (at first) and seuraavaksi (next).
The object of kiittää is in the partitive here. How would we add the reason we are thanking them, like "for their visit"?
The verb kiittää takes the partitive case for the person being thanked (kaikkia vieraita), but it requires the elative case (ending in -sta or -stä) for the reason. To say "we thank all the guests for their visit", you would say kiitämme kaikkia vieraita vierailusta. This is a highly useful verb rule to master at this level.
How is the partitive plural vieraita formed from the base word vieras?
Words ending in -as or -äs have a long vowel stem ending in -aa- or -ää- (which you see in the genitive singular vieraan). To form the partitive plural, you take that strong stem vieraa-, shorten the long vowel by dropping one a to make room for the plural marker i, and add the partitive suffix -ta. This creates the form vieraita.
Why is the word for "we" missing before kiitämme?
In standard Finnish, first and second person pronouns (minä, sinä, me, te) are routinely dropped because the verb ending (here, -mme) already makes it completely clear who is doing the action. As an English speaker, you might be tempted to always include it, but adding me sounds unnatural here unless you are specifically emphasizing that we are doing the thanking, as opposed to someone else.
